The Ultimate Guide to Losing Belly Fat
So, you're eagerly wanting to drop that stubborn belly fat? It’s a typical goal, and thankfully, it's absolutely achievable! This guide will break down the essential steps involved. Forget quick fixes; we're focusing on sustainable lifestyle changes. First, nutrition is paramount – you need to provide your body with wholesome foods like lean protein, fruits, vegetables, and healthy fats while avoiding processed foods, sugary drinks, and excessive carbohydrates. Exercise plays a vital role too; incorporate both cardio activities (like jogging) and strength training to burn calories and build muscle. Strength training particularly helps because it increases your metabolic rate, which means you'll stay burning more calories even when at rest. Finally, don’t underestimate the power of lifestyle factors like getting enough sleep (7-9 hours) to manage stress and maintain hormonal balance – all crucial for fat reduction. Slimming Myths Debunked: What Truly Works
So, you're wanting to shed weight? You’ve undoubtedly seen countless claims about the “simplest” way to achieve it. Unfortunately, many of these are just falsehoods. Let's take a look at several common weight loss beliefs and separate fact from fiction. Forget the radical diets; sustainable change involves grasping what *actually* works.
- Myth: Skipping meals accelerates metabolism. Truth: It usually hinders it, leading to overeating later.
- Myth: "Detox" diets or drinks eliminate toxins and promote rapid weight loss. Truth: Your body has its own efficient systems (liver & kidneys) – these are often just expensive losses of water.
- Myth: You need to do endless cardio for fat burning. Truth: Strength training builds muscle, which increases your resting metabolic rate—contributing to burning more calories even when you’re at rest.
- Myth: All calories are created equal. Truth: While calorie intake is important, the *source* of those calories – protein, carbs, and fats – significantly impacts your body's effect and overall health.
The ideal approach to weight loss is a combination of nutritious food choices, regular physical activity you enjoy, and realistic goals. Focus on making gradual, long-term changes that you can keep up more info with for a healthier, happier you—circumventing these common misconceptions is key.
